2013-12-15 5 views
7

मेरे पास विंडोज के लिए PyCharm 3.0 स्थापित है और स्थापित IronPython 2.7.4 स्थापित है। लेकिन ऐसा लगता है कि मैं संदर्भ प्राप्त करने में सक्षम नहीं हूं और यह कुछ डिग्री तक नेट कक्षाओं को पहचान नहीं पाएगा।PyCharm और IronPython Codecompletion?

मैं आपको एक सरल उदाहरण देता हूँ:

import clr 
clr.AddReference("System.Windows.Forms") 

from System.Windows.Forms import MessageBox 
MessageBox.Show("Hello World") 

मैं चला सकते हैं/यह बिल्कुल ठीक अमल लेकिन आईडीई मुझे पता चलता है कि यह सिस्टम http://i.imgur.com/Aml9DuM.png

पहचान नहीं कर सकते तो आप इस कल्पना कर सकते हैं कुछ हद तक है ... इसे हल्के ढंग से डालने के लिए निराशाजनक, alt + दबाकर दबाएं और फिर बिनरे मॉड्यूल XXXXX के लिए स्टब्स जेनरेट करें "और फिर सभी अनसुलझा संदर्भ समस्याओं को ठीक करने के लिए इसे हल नहीं किया जाएगा क्योंकि मैं .NET कक्षाओं के लिए कक्षा परिभाषाओं को देखने में सक्षम होना चाहता हूं।

तो अगर कोई इसे काम करने में कामयाब रहा है तो मैं अंतर्दृष्टि की सराहना करता हूं। हां, मुझे पता है कि मैं विजुअल स्टूडियो के लिए पायथन टूल में आयरनपीथन का उपयोग कर सकता हूं लेकिन मैं भी PyCharm में काम करने में सक्षम होना चाहता हूं।

बस संदर्भ के लिए यह है कि क्या मैं दृश्य स्टूडियो के लिए अजगर उपकरण में मिलता है और क्या मैं PyCharm में enter image description here

उत्तर

4

यह PyCharm में एक बग प्रतीत होता है ऐसा करना चाहते हैं, मैंने reported it here, वोट करें है।

+1

धन्यवाद, मुझे आशा है कि यह जल्द ही ठीक हो जाएगा = / – Orbital